NeocoreGames released a new trailer to introduce Lady Katarina.

Lady Katarina is a ghost with snappy wit that comes to the support of Van Helsing on his supernatural hunt to uncover the mystery of a new scientific scourge in the land of Borgovia. Katarina is of great aid to Van Helsing as she comes with her own abilities and behaviors to boost the hunter's hit points, mana, damage, and much more. Having her own skill tree, three different forms, magical tricks, and the capability to travel to the nearest town to buy and sell items, Katarina is essential for Van Helsing's adventure. Whether it is freezing enemies in place or summoning a brutal bolt of energy, her assistance is highly valued when it comes to ferocious battles in the wilderness.
